This bill, the MINKS are Superspreaders Act, prohibits the breeding and possession of American mink raised in captivity for fur production nationwide. It amends the Animal Welfare Act to ban related activities like transport and sale, with limited exceptions. Additionally, the legislation establishes a voluntary federal buy-out program for existing mink farms, contingent upon available funding.

The Military in Law Enforcement Accountability Act establishes new requirements and strict time limits for the Department of Defense when providing support to civilian law enforcement agencies, requiring prior Congressional notification and justification. It also prohibits Department of Defense personnel from simultaneously serving in civilian law enforcement roles, with limited exceptions for reservists. Furthermore, the bill broadens the circumstances under which military and federal law enforcement can assist civil authorities and creates a private right of action for violations of the Act.

This bill establishes the **Temporary Immigration Judge Integrity Act** to authorize the Attorney General to appoint highly qualified, temporary immigration judges for limited terms. These temporary judges are intended to supplement, not replace, permanent judges and must meet specific experience requirements. The legislation mandates rigorous oversight, training protocols, and limits the total service time for these temporary appointments to ensure judicial integrity.

The Right to Read Act of 2025 amends federal education law to establish a comprehensive "right to read" for all students, ensuring access to evidence-based instruction, effective school libraries, and diverse reading materials. The bill defines key terms like "effective school library" and mandates that states and local agencies detail plans to support these resources and protect students' First Amendment rights regarding information access. Furthermore, it authorizes significant new funding to improve literacy programs, support school librarians, and mandates national data collection on school library resources.

This resolution designates December 8, 2025, as "Jimmy Lai Day" to honor his advocacy for press freedom, religious freedom, and democracy in Hong Kong. It condemns the actions of the People's Republic of China and Hong Kong authorities for suppressing fundamental freedoms and calls for the immediate release of Jimmy Lai and all unjustly imprisoned pro-democracy advocates.

The Dignity for Detained Immigrants Act aims to overhaul immigration detention by establishing mandatory, high standards based on ABA guidelines and increasing transparency through rigorous, unannounced inspections. The bill prohibits the use of private, for-profit detention facilities within three years and ends the mandatory detention of most noncitizens, prioritizing release or community-based alternatives. Furthermore, it establishes new due process rights, including timely custody hearings, a presumption of release, and prohibitions on detaining children or using solitary confinement.

The Upholding Protections for Unaccompanied Children Act of 2025 seeks to reverse harmful provisions affecting unaccompanied children. This bill eliminates various immigration-related fees for current and former unaccompanied children, including those for asylum and employment authorization. It also prohibits physically intrusive medical examinations and restricts the sharing of sponsor information with immigration enforcement agencies. Furthermore, the Act mandates the refunding of previously paid fees.

This resolution strongly condemns the Iranian government for its ongoing, state-sponsored persecution of the Baha'i religious minority, which violates international human rights laws. It documents systematic abuses, including economic restrictions, denial of education, and arbitrary arrests, noting that these actions may constitute a crime against humanity. The resolution calls on Iran to immediately release all imprisoned Bahais and urges the U.S. President and Secretary of State to condemn these violations and impose sanctions on responsible officials.

The Make Housing Affordable and Defend Democracy Act aims to increase housing accessibility through several tax incentives while simultaneously rescinding significant funding previously allocated for immigration enforcement. Key provisions establish new tax credits for first-time homebuyers, builders of starter homes, and the conversion of commercial buildings into affordable rentals. Additionally, the bill introduces a Renter Tax Credit for those spending over 30% of their income on rent, with an option for monthly advance payments.

The Dismantle Foreign Scam Syndicates Act establishes a high-level Task Force, chaired by the Secretary of State, to develop and execute a comprehensive U.S. strategy against transnational criminal organizations running massive online scams, often utilizing victims of human trafficking in Southeast Asia. This strategy must focus on disrupting these operations, sanctioning responsible parties, and providing support for rescued victims. The bill authorizes $30 million over two years to fund these efforts and requires annual reporting to Congress on progress and impact.

The Increasing Medication Access for Seniors Act of 2025 establishes new reporting requirements for the Secretary of Health and Human Services regarding the Medicare Part D monthly capped cost-sharing option. These regular reports must detail enrollment numbers, potential beneficiaries, and implementation efforts for point-of-sale elections. The goal is to track and improve access to predictable prescription drug cost management for seniors on Medicare Part D.

This bill, the Save Oak Flat from Foreign Mining Act, withdraws approximately 2,422 acres of Forest Service land known as Oak Flat in Arizona from all forms of mineral entry and development. It specifically cancels the prior land exchange that would have transferred the land to Resolution Copper Mining, LLC. The Act prohibits the transfer of Oak Flat to the foreign-backed mining venture, citing national security and environmental concerns.

The Veteran Education Empowerment Act establishes a grant program to help colleges and universities create and operate dedicated Student Veteran Centers. These centers will serve as centralized hubs to coordinate academic support, transition services, and community building for student veterans. The bill authorizes funding for these grants, which can be used for establishing and operating the centers, with specific reporting requirements to track effectiveness.

This resolution celebrates the 50th anniversary of the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A), recognizing its landmark achievement in guaranteeing a free, appropriate public education for every child with a disability. It honors the law's transformative impact since 1975, which ensured access, protected rights, and established critical early intervention services. The resolution reaffirms the commitment to fully implementing IDEA so all students with disabilities have the opportunity to thrive.

The Mikaela Naylon Give Kids a Chance Act focuses primarily on improving pediatric drug development and ensuring patient access to necessary treatments. This legislation mandates new research requirements for molecularly targeted pediatric cancer drugs, strengthens FDA enforcement of pediatric study completion, and extends incentives for developing drugs for rare pediatric diseases. Additionally, the bill updates organ transplant network functions and establishes an Abraham Accords Office within the FDA to enhance international regulatory cooperation.

This resolution declares that immigrant justice and reproductive justice are inseparable, demanding that both movements be pursued together. It condemns systemic failures and policies that deny immigrants access to necessary reproductive health care while in custody or in the community. The resolution calls on Congress and federal agencies to eliminate barriers to health coverage and ensure equitable, comprehensive reproductive care for all individuals, regardless of immigration status.

This bill proposes amending the House Rules to increase the threshold required for disciplinary action against a Member, Delegate, or Resident Commissioner. Specifically, it mandates that a supermajority of at least 60% of votes cast must support any resolution for censure, disapproval, or removal from committee membership. This change establishes a higher bar for imposing these specific forms of House discipline.

The LEAD Act of 2025 seeks to prohibit the use of lead ammunition on all lands and waters managed by the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service due to documented health and environmental risks. This legislation mandates the creation of a certified list of approved nonlead ammunition alternatives for use on these federal lands. The bill establishes civil penalties for knowing violations of this new prohibition.

This resolution supports the goals of Transgender Day of Remembrance by recognizing the ongoing epidemic of violence targeting transgender people, particularly transgender women of color. It memorializes the lives lost this year and highlights the systemic barriers, including discrimination and lack of healthcare access, faced by the transgender community. The bill calls for urgent action from the government to protect these lives through inclusive legislation and policies that ensure dignity and respect for all individuals.

This bill mandates that the FEMA Administrator administer the Next Generation Warning System grant program. It requires the immediate disbursement of obligated 2022 funds and the initiation of grant awards for fiscal years 2023 and 2024. Additionally, the bill calls for research and development to improve the accessibility, resiliency, and security of emergency warning systems.
